If you’re thinking of starting to get in shape again after a break you need to take it easy and ease your way back into an exercise program. If you’ve never done a press up don’t blast the gym in a bid to get in shape overnight. You need to start slowly and develop exercise as a habit, otherwise chances are you’ll remember how hard the gym was and never go back. Or worse still – get an injury and spend weeks recovering. Starting an exercise program can be a huge shock though, and you need to begin at a level which you can maintain throughout the weeks and months to come. Losing weight and obtaining the much desired six pack is another matter altogether, but once you have got the ball rolling it’s completely within grasp.
Using a few principles in order to lose weight and get your body back in shape again is better than only having one set of routines. For starters you will get bored of your routine so will need to keep changing it and having a few ‘tools in your box” so to speak will definitely help you to keep the ball rolling. Working on cardiovascular exercise like running, cycling and swimming, for example is a great way to get fit but alone it won’t necessarily shift the excess fat. By lifting weights, either your own body weight, machines or free weights, you are helping your body to increase its metabolism and keeping the furnace fired up at all times.
If you also factor in a shift in your diet, no matter how small to start with, you are using many ways to increase metabolism, take regular exercise, lower calorie intake and burn body fat. Provided you do these things in the right way and with the correct knowledge, you are in for a much easier time of it than simply pounding the pavement.
